Transaction 21fcdd67d23226366bd5abed44ad5b7c8f93885af6e3e678c35f139c627a6a34

1 Input
2 Outputs
  • 21fcdd67d23226366bd5abed44ad5b7c8f93885af6e3e678c35f139c627a6a34:0
  • value  110000000
    address  1Eekct9sL4wCes2MedN2BNUrS7o75Qu3Fo
  • 21fcdd67d23226366bd5abed44ad5b7c8f93885af6e3e678c35f139c627a6a34:1
  • value  89948158
    address  1C13iZjZ1SEcHm5yVEkGqbbgyp2aeXKs4s